The new Service from Knowledge has just released a page showing exactly how it will deal with a bankruptcy filing you to attempts to getting discharging student loans. However, there are no set laws while the habit has not yet been setup yet, new letter brings a road map getting whenever legal counsel is always to try to launch student education loans within the bankruptcy proceeding.

Will cost you In order to Litigate Experienced

To launch college loans into the a personal bankruptcy, the attorneys must file a challenger continuing just before discharging student funds. From the challenger, attorneys need certainly to allege you to definitely demanding installment to the education loan have a tendency to trigger an excessive adversity contrary to the Borrower. As the grievance are recorded, the newest Service off Degree must decide whether or not to tournament the new test on discharging brand new student loans. This is how the latest Department’s page is important. The brand new letter indicated that in case your costs to follow the issue in the bankruptcy proceeding courtroom surpass that-3rd of your own full balance to your weight (integrated interest and you will collection can cost you), then your loan company could possibly get accept rather than oppose the newest undue difficulty claim.

The newest Page plus noted a good amount of what to meet the requirements because of the lenders whether to competition a student-based loan release. The next circumstances was:

  • If a debtor has actually recorded having bankruptcy proceeding on account of issues past their control while the impression such as for instance basis(s) provides toward debtor’s ability to repay this new education loan debt. And this includesa separation resulting in diminution out of members of the family money, that will not logically become reestablished.
  • If a borrower just who claims undue adversity on account of real or rational impairment may qualify for Total and you can Permanent Impairment Launch (TPD) and/or any other management discharges available.   • Veterans who have been dependent on the latest Institution off Pros Products as unemployable on account of a support-linked disability.
  • Whether or not a debtor is actually approaching old-age, taking into consideration debtor’s years at that time student loans had been incurred, and you can information more likely offered to the debtor during the old age to settle the new student loan personal debt. Consumers which choose to bear student loan debt at the a mature ages, if one obligations is for by themselves or a reliant (we.e,, Mother As well as financing), should not be in a position to have confidence in how old they are alone and you may/otherwise their entrances into old age to prove undue difficulty.
  • Whether or not a debtor’s wellness has actually materially altered because the education loan personal debt try obtain.
  • Whether or not tall time has elapsed because the debt is actually obtain.
  • Whether a good debtor’s costs is actually realistic and you can indicate minimization away from way too many costs to incorporate funds to own education loan repayment.
  • If a borrower met with the rational and you will/or real capacity to realize management launch solutions and you will/or earnings-determined fees arrangements, if those people possibilities were not pursued, otherwise whether a debtor had one actual otherwise psychological affairs that would have generated new management procedure so much more burdensome for the borrower.

Hypothetical Examples of Excessive Adversity Items

Facts: Borrower gets student loans to finish an excellent Master’s education. On graduation she initiate functioning and you will to make money. A couple of years shortly after their graduation, her man will get undoubtedly ill, without possibility of healing, demanding round-the-clock proper care. The new children’s problems is actually followed closely by a divorce or separation, with no son assistance or alimony certain. So it number of items makes the borrower not able to functions full-big date on account of childcare debt. She really works region-date, introducing merely a portion of the lady complete-go out income. The girl children’s scientific costs also are high.

Analysis: The information more than reveal that debtor showed readiness to repay the lady loans and did so when the lady information allowed, and this their personal bankruptcy filing and online payday loans Massachusetts you can situations have been due to products past the girl manage. Additionally, the new situations one triggered her financial difficulties will likely persist. The Agency thinks you to a pattern such as this do warrant examining some of the money-motivated payment selection. In the event the this type of choices are not available and you may/or dont relieve the financial hardship, a permission in order to undue difficulty release, either in complete or area, are compatible.
